Project Overview

The project topic "Predictive Modeling of Stock Prices Using Time Series Analysis" involves utilizing advanced statistical methods to forecast and predict stock prices based on historical data patterns. Time series analysis is a powerful technique that enables researchers to analyze and model data points collected at regular intervals over time. In the context of stock prices, time series analysis can help identify trends, seasonal patterns, and other important factors that influence stock market fluctuations. The primary objective of this research project is to develop predictive models that can accurately forecast stock prices based on historical data. By applying sophisticated statistical techniques to time series data, researchers aim to uncover meaningful relationships and patterns that can be used to make informed predictions about future stock price movements. This research is especially relevant for investors, financial analysts, and policymakers who rely on accurate stock price forecasts to make strategic decisions in the stock market. The research will involve collecting and analyzing historical stock price data from various sources, such as financial markets and online databases. Researchers will then apply time series analysis techniques, such as autoregressive integrated moving average (ARIMA) models, exponential smoothing, and machine learning algorithms, to develop predictive models. These models will be evaluated based on their accuracy in forecasting future stock prices and compared against traditional forecasting methods. Furthermore, the research will explore the limitations and challenges of using time series analysis for stock price prediction, such as data quality issues, model complexity, and the impact of external factors on stock market volatility. By addressing these challenges, researchers aim to enhance the reliability and accuracy of stock price forecasts generated through time series analysis.
